Danville is located in Georgia. Danville, Georgia has a population of 209. Danville is more family-centric than the surrounding county with 18.18%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 17.8%.
The median household income in Danville, Georgia is $59,028. The median household income for the surrounding county is $45,824 compared to the national median of $69,021. The median age of people living in Danville is 55.2 years.
The average high temperature in July is 92.5 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 34.7 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 46 inches per year, with 0.3 inches of snow per year.
